Multi-branch stimulation electrode for subcutaneous field stimulation

1. An implantable electrode array system, comprising:

  • (a) a multi-branch electrode array, the multi-branch electrode array comprising a plurality of elongated branches extending along an insertion axis, wherein each branch includes at least one electrode contact and a blunt dissecting distal tip;

    (b) a plurality of removable stiffening components configured to bias the plurality of elongate branches toward a deployed configuration, wherein the plurality of stiffening components are linked by a stiffening element hub, wherein each of the plurality of stiffening components extends through at least a portion of one of the plurality of elongated branches; and

    (c) an implantation cartridge for moving the multi-branch electrode array from a retracted position to a deployed position, wherein the branches are maintained in a retracted configuration when the multi-branch electrode array is in the retracted position, wherein, when in the retracted position, the branches are positioned proximally relative to the implantation cartridge, and, wherein, when in the deployed position, the branches are in the deployed configuration and extend distally and laterally outwardly along a first transverse orientation, relative to the insertion axis, from the implantation cartridge a further distance than in the retracted configuration;

    wherein, when in the deployed configuration, the branches are positioned with a first branch disposed between a second branch and a third branch, and a fourth branch disposed between the second branch and the first branch so that the electrode array is distributed along a thin surface.
